❓ What Exactly Is Amenorrhea Anyway?

Amenorrhea sounds fancy, but it’s just a big word for when your period decides to ghost you 🚫 menstruation. There are two types: primary (when someone hasn’t started their period by age 16) and secondary (when your cycle suddenly vanishes after being regular). While no period might sound like a dream come true at first 🎉, it could signal an underlying issue that impacts fertility. Spoiler alert: No period doesn’t always mean no chance of babies!


🌱 Can Amenorrhea Affect Fertility?

The short answer is yes, amenorrhea can affect fertility—but don’t panic yet! Your menstrual cycle is closely tied to ovulation, which is essential for getting pregnant. If your body isn’t releasing eggs regularly, conception becomes trickier. But here’s some good news: many causes of amenorrhea, such as stress, extreme exercise, or hormonal imbalances, are treatable. Think of it like fixing a traffic jam on the road to parenthood 🚗💨. Once the cause is addressed, things often get back on track.


💡 How Can You Improve Your Chances of Pregnancy?

If amenorrhea has thrown a wrench into your baby plans, there are plenty of ways to tackle it. First, visit your doctor to identify the root cause—this could involve blood tests, ultrasounds, or even lifestyle changes. For example, if weight loss or gain triggered your skipped periods, adjusting your diet and fitness routine might help bring balance back. And hey, who doesn’t love a solid self-care plan? 🥑🧘‍♀️

In some cases, medications like birth control pills or fertility drugs may be prescribed to kickstart ovulation. Remember, every body is different, so finding the right solution takes patience and teamwork with your healthcare provider.
